Methodist University invites applicants for a full-time, 12-month, visiting, non-tenure track, one-year, renewable appointment at the rank of Assistant Professor.  This position begins January 1, 2026.  Previous teaching experience in a Physician Assistant program is strongly recommended.  Full-time faculty members are required to maintain practice skills and are given one day each week to engage in clinical practice.  Salary is commensurate with the level of education as well as professional and academic experience. 

 

Responsibilities include:

  • Provide student instruction in the didactic and clinical phases of the program.
  • Teach and assist in labs as needed
  • Participate in the evaluation of student performance throughout the didactic and clinical phases of the program
  • Assist with the remediation process of students in both the didactic and clinical phases of the program
  • Participate in the selection of applicants for admission to the PA program
  • Serve as a student academic advisor as assigned by the program director
  • Actively participate in designing, implementing, coordinating, and evaluating the curriculum
  • Participate in the evaluation of the program
  • Other duties as assigned by the program director

 

Application:

Review of applications will begin immediately and continue until the position is filled.  Qualified candidates are invited to submit the following:

  1. Letter of intent
  2. Curriculum vitae
  3. Teaching philosophy statement
  4. Transcripts
  5. Contact information for three references

 

Methodist University Physician Assistant Program is an accredited, seven-semester graduate program with an enrollment of 40 students each year (aggregate enrollment 120).  For inquiries, contact April Martin, PA-C, Program Director, [email protected].   

Qualifications

Minimum qualifications for this position include:

  • Master’s degree, a minimum of three years of clinical practice as a physician assistant with eligibility for unrestricted licensure to practice in North Carolina, and current certification by the NCCPA.

What you need to know about the Charlotte Tech Scene

Ranked among the hottest tech cities in 2024 by CompTIA, Charlotte is quickly cementing its place as a major U.S. tech hub. Home to more than 90,000 tech workers, the city’s ecosystem is primed for continued growth, fueled by billions in annual funding from heavyweights like Microsoft and RevTech Labs, which has created thousands of fintech jobs and made the city a go-to for tech pros looking for their next big opportunity.

Key Facts About Charlotte Tech

  • Number of Tech Workers: 90,859; 6.5%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
  • Major Tech Employers: Lowe’s, Bank of America, TIAA, Microsoft, Honeywell
  • Key Industries: Fintech, artificial intelligence, cybersecurity, cloud computing, e-commerce
  • Funding Landscape: $3.1 billion in venture capital funding in 2024 (CED)
  • Notable Investors: Microsoft, Google, Falfurrias Management Partners, RevTech Labs Foundation
  • Research Centers and Universities: University of North Carolina at Charlotte, Northeastern University, North Carolina Research Campus
